Transaction dd895b93a973bb500b62f88ebd7362524d64bebc60c2d904c426e058bc9bf656
1 Input
1 Output
-
dd895b93a973bb500b62f88ebd7362524d64bebc60c2d904c426e058bc9bf656:0
- value
- 4625550
- script pubkey
- OP_0 OP_PUSHBYTES_20 d87e87707e51d2daaf0f7fd87976dbfe623b6c11
- address
- bc1qmplgwur728fd4tc00lv8jakmle3rkmq302zh7l